ROBLES FRANCIA, Víctor Hugo; CONTRERAS TORRES, Françoise; BARBOSA RAMIREZ, David  e  JUAREZ ACOSTA, Fernando. Leadership in Colombian mexican managers: A comparative study. Investig. desarro. [online]. 2013, vol.21, n.2, pp.395-418. ISSN 2011-7574.

We compared leadership practices between a group composed of101 Colombian managers and another group composed of 121 Mexican managers. We distributed the Leadership Practices Inventory (Kouzes and Posner, 2002) to evaluate their type of leadership. The results showed that, although Colombian managers report higher scores in every practice, the pattern looks similar in both groups. The practice receiving a lower score in both groups was To Inspire while the practice with the highest score was To Model the Way, both of them related to transformational leadership. The only practices that showed significant differences between the two groups were To Model the Way, for the transformational leadership style, and To Encourage the Heart, for the transactional leadership style. We conclude that both Colombian and Mexican managers possess a similar pattern with small differences in frequency between them
